WebMay 24, 2024 · The Wi-Fi signal strength is highlighted in the screenshot ( Signal: 72% ). Using PowerShell, you can get only the signal strength value in a percent: (netsh wlan show interfaces) -Match '^\s+Signal' -Replace '^\s+Signal\s+:\s+',''. Running the CD\ command to change the directory to root. agriturismi provincia di milanoWebMar 11, 2024 · These commands list visible networks and they work in both cmd prompt & PowerShell. Code: netsh wlan show networks. or. Code: netsh wlan show networks mode=bssid. I use these commands frequently and have not had any problems with them.
